Pros and Spikeless Golf Shoes

Professional golfers are known for their meticulous attention to equipment and apparel, and golf shoes are no exception. While traditionally, spiked shoes were the norm among pros for their superior traction and stability, many are now opting for spikeless golf shoes. This shift is influenced by several factors that enhance performance and comfort on the course.

Spikeless golf shoes are designed with a rubber outsole featuring various patterns that provide grip without the need for traditional spikes. Some reasons professionals might choose spikeless shoes include:

  • Comfort: Many spikeless designs prioritize comfort, often incorporating advanced cushioning and breathable materials.
  • Versatility: Spikeless shoes can be worn off the course, allowing for a seamless transition from the fairway to casual settings.
  • Weight: They tend to be lighter than their spiked counterparts, which can contribute to better mobility during a swing.
  • Maintenance: Spikeless shoes require less maintenance, as there are no spikes to replace or clean.

Performance Comparison

When evaluating the performance of spikeless versus spiked golf shoes, various factors come into play, including traction, stability, and overall comfort. Below is a comparative analysis:

Feature Spiked Shoes Spikeless Shoes
Traction Excellent on wet or uneven surfaces Good for normal conditions; may slip in heavy rain
Stability Offers maximum stability during swings Stable enough for most players; may vary by brand
Comfort Can be less comfortable due to stiffness Generally more comfortable with flexible designs
Weight Heavier due to spikes Lighter, enhancing mobility
Versatility Designed specifically for golf Can be worn off the course

Conditions Influencing Choice

The choice between spiked and spikeless shoes can depend on course conditions:

  • Dry Conditions: Many professionals opt for spikeless shoes when playing on dry, firm courses, where the need for maximum traction is reduced.
  • Wet or Soft Conditions: Spiked shoes may still be favored on soggy or muddy courses, where additional grip can prevent slipping during swings.

Are spikeless golf shoes suitable for all weather conditions?
While spikeless shoes perform well in dry conditions, they may not provide the same level of grip on wet or muddy surfaces compared to traditional spiked shoes. Players should consider the weather and course conditions when choosing footwear.
